443- Mary Mazzarello, ‘C U in Heaven’

Saint Mary Mazzarello died at age 44. Her last words, “I’ll see you in Heaven.”

Saint Bosco of the Salesians asked St Mary Mazzarello to create the Daughters of Mary, Help of Christians (aka Salesian Sisters) to care for abandoned girls.

Mary Mazzarello immediately recalled a vision she had at age nine about a big building filled with orphaned girls.

 As her ministry grew she was on the hunt for a larger facility. She found the perfect building and realized it looked just as she remembered from her childhood dream!  

The Daughters of Mary is now a world-wide organization.
